This can be useful when you want to maintain links in journal entries, character biographies, macros, and more. If you check the Keep Document IDs option on import it will use the same ID as the document in the compendium pack. When you import a document like an actor or a journal entry into your world Foundry will generate a new ID for it. Keep Document IDs Every document in Foundry VTT has a unique ID that represents it. You'll also have an option to Keep Document IDs. It will use the compendium's name if you choose not to edit the name, or if you leave the field blank. This will open a dialog box allowing you to change the name of the folder which the compendium pack's content should be imported into. If you would like to import all of the content in a compendium pack you can do so by right-clicking the pack in the Compendium tab of the sidebar, then selecting the "Import All Content" option. Even though each Actor, Item, or other document may be small, as their numbers start to rise into the hundreds the amount of data that gets transferred to each of your players when they join can cause your world to slow down over time. Do I need a Compendium? Storing unused Documents in a Compendium greatly reduces the time it takes to load your world. Note that you will receive a warning and be asked to confirm your choice to unlock compendia that are included in game systems and modules, but not within your own worlds. This will lock or unlock the chosen compendium. To lock and unlock a compendium, go to the Compendium Packs tab, right click a compendium, and choose the "Toggle Edit Lock" option. You can only export folders to compendium packs which are unlocked. If you check the Keep Document IDs option on export it will use the same ID as the document in the world. When you export a document like an actor or a journal entry into a compendium pack Foundry will generate a new ID for it. When it's unchecked Foundry will create new copies of those documents. When exporting content to a compendium pack you'll have two additional choices: Merge By Name When Merge By Name is checked Foundry will overwrite existing documents that have the same name as one of your exported documents. To export content to a compendium pack the pack will need to be unlocked. Compendium Packs and their contents are automatically sorted alphabetically.

You can also export whole folders to a compendium pack by right clicking the folder and clicking the "Export to Compendium" option. Enter the name of the compendium (for example "Player Characters") and choose the type of document (like actors, items, or journal entries) that will be contained in it from the Document Type dropdown.Īfter your compendium has been created, clicking on the its name in the sidebar will open a new window that will allow you to drag and drop from a sidebar tab into the compendium. First, navigate to the Compendium Packs sidebar tab, and then click the "Create Compendium" button. Creating and Using Compendium PacksĪ compendium can be easily created in any World (if you're interested in making a module with compendium packs check out our Content Packaging Guide). Data contained in compendium packs are not loaded until needed, reducing the amount of data that a particular user must load when first joining a game. Compendium Packs should be used to help you keep your world organized and reduce clutter.Ĭompendium packs are also used by modules to store large amounts of content to be unpacked and added to an existing game world, such as part of a premium or exclusive content pack.Įach Compendium can only contain one type of document: Actors, Items, Journal Entries, Macro Commands, Playlists, Rollable Tables or Scenes. When these elements are not in use, but are not ready to be deleted, they should be stored in compendia. OverviewĬompendium Packs exist to reduce the strain on worlds that have accrued a large number of actors, items, macros, playlists, rollable tables, or scenes.
